Bradley Bullock's incredible winning streak continued when he purchased a scratch-off ticket and discovered it was worth $10 million, leading him to join the "millionaires club." He felt lucky after winning $2,000 at the casino the night before and combined that with a successful lottery purchase. Upon scanning the ticket with the Lottery app, he realized he had won before even scratching it, which led to a thrilling experience of confirming his extraordinary fortune.
"I was able to sleep in a little because I didn't have to work, but I needed a little caffeine pick-me-up, so I got an energy drink and a couple of scratchers," Bullock shared about the day he bought the winning ticket. His casual approach to the day resulted in an astonishing financial windfall after a night of casino victories, showcasing the wonderful unpredictability of luck.
"I knew I'd won before I even scratched it because I scanned the barcode with the Lottery app," Bullock said.
